Total Visits

Views
Zoología370
Zoología(legacy)106

Total Visits Per Month

January 2024February 2024March 2024April 2024May 2024June 2024July 2024
Zoología6355754

Top country views

Views
United States140
Spain130
China18
Sweden13
Germany11
United Kingdom10
Italy6
Singapore6
Ireland5
India4

Top cities views

Views
Brea35
Stafford13
Sevilla8
Zhuhai8
Madrid7
Ashburn6
León6
Mountain View6
Redwood City6
Solna6